RESUMO

The paper discusses the status of polymorphonuclear neutrophils (PMN) in untreated patients with stage III and IV lung and stomach cancer. Pronounced increase in peripheral blood neutrophil count was matched by decrease in the level of leukocyte cationic proteins. In vitro cytotoxic activity of PMN against K-562 cells was significantly higher in cancer patients, as compared to healthy controls, and unaccompanied by reaction of neutrophils to stimuli. NBT-test value variation range appeared wider in cancer patients than in controls.
